Transaction 5fa688a2c7240f1abf84de9f2e59013f389aba68fb104c662e9a0cd48dbe6fa8
1 Input
1 Output
-
5fa688a2c7240f1abf84de9f2e59013f389aba68fb104c662e9a0cd48dbe6fa8:0
- value
- 686740
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 01d1c104dfc19b0b7d9a0d3f94f885b3f302d4e5 OP_EQUAL
- address
- 31rdshRAprnTNmBzZyFqyRVwqRqCWEeauL